I also got stung on an order placed 13th March 2017. After digging around it seems that prior to April 2016, Moby Memory were a legitimate business (as it was recommended to me by a friend) and had been trading since 2009. However, in April 2015, the company dissolved and a new company was registered (Company number 10099753) on 4th April 2016 under the same name. This new company has been trading fraudulently since then and the owners name is SHAH, Meetul. The company registration number they quote on their website (08775950) is incorrect - this actually relates to a company called NEWBAY TRADING LIMITED and it's directors are named as 1) MONERY, Christopher Tom, 3a, Livingstone Court, 55 Peel Road, Harrow, Middlesex, United Kingdom, HA3 7QT 2) SHAH, Heeran - 3a, Livingstone Court, 55 Peel Road, Harrow, Middlesex, HA3 7QT and 3) KAHAN, Barbara - Winnington House, 2 Woodberry Grove, North Finchley, London, United Kingdom, N12 0DR. Heeran Shah and Meetul Shah are brothers aged 30 and 27 respectively. It seems that illegal activity runs in the family. The website is clearly fraudulent and they have pounced on unsuspecting customers who used and trusted Moby Memory in the past. I guess we can all learn to be more diligent online and do our research.

I brought a Samsung note 4 battery from this seller roughly 9 months ago. After 6 months the battery exploded causing damage to my flooring and my glasses as the phone was on my bed side table. I contacted Samsung regarding this who investigated the issue and found that the battery was not genuine. I contact Moby Memory who have lied to me multiple times saying they have contacted "Samsung" and then finally stating that they never sold me the battery as they had no S/N matching the battery when I know for a fact that they sold me this battery. They have just tried to fob me off and cannot be trusted. If the battery had exploded and I had not realised the results could have been very different as the battery was on fire. If you value your life please do not buy from Moby Memory as they lie continously and state they sell genuine products when infact they do not.

I ordered a new battery for my iPhone but was sent a second hand battery. When I opened the package it was in very poor condition and it was obvious that it had been taken out of another phone. The battery they sent had a cycle count of 1027 and a maximum charge of 1313 mAh (only 82% of it’s design capacity of 1560 mAh). They have accepted the return but have not sent a returns envelope after several requests. I'm still waiting for a refund. I'm really unhappy with the product and their customer service is very poor. I feel that this is dishonest and not an acceptable way for a company to act.
